This is an overview of episodes 50 to 71 in the series, 7 Days to Die.

The new season starts due to the Alpha 10 update. After entering a strange subterranean chamber at the end of the previous season, Aaron and Emre mysteriously find themselves in a new wilderness, having lost all of their gear and some of their memories. They choose to blame the memory wipe on the drugs Aaron had slipped into their Thanksgiving meal.

After holing up in a series of temporary refuges, Aaron and Emre establish a new base atop an island spire at the edge of a large lake. They finally encounter another survivor, a mysterious woman called SP Cakes who quickly proves to be antagonistic and deadly. A lengthy and destructive battle against SP Cakes leaves Aaron and Emre's island base in ruins, so the pair spend several harrowing days attempting to scavenge for supplies.

Eventually, Aaron and Emre encounter a new pair of survivors, medhathobo and The Jade Grue. Assuming the newcomers to be in league with SP Cakes, Aaron and Emre go on the offensive, spending the rest of the season engaged in a grueling siege on the strangers' fort.

This season updates to Alpha 10 and takes place in a new randomly generated world map. A major new addition to the game in this series is the ability to customize characters' appearances and clothing. For the first time, Aaron and Emre are no longer identical, but they have not yet adopted the appearances they'll eventually stick with. This alpha also introduces Wellness as a measure of a survivor's maximum Health and Stamina, which does not benefit Emre whatsoever. 

One quirk of the random map generation in Alpha 10 is a number of incomplete buildings Aaron and Emre encounter, which they interpret as a "Japanese style house," a "free-range prison," and a Pop 'n' Pills pharmacy where "something bad happened."

This season can be divided into four basic arcs. In Episodes 50 - 57, Aaron and Emre explore their unfamiliar surroundings, battle zombies, and establish a new fort, all while imagining what they would do if they ever met other survivors (particularly women).

In Episodes 58 - 61, Aaron and Emre first encounter their nemesis SP Cakes. They engage in a grueling, deadly, and disastrous battle with her, resulting in the partial destruction of their fort.

In Episodes 62 - 66, Aaron and Emre head into the city in desperate need of supplies so they can rebuild. In their weakened condition, the supply run turns into a ceaseless zombie nightmare.

Finally, in Episodes 67 - 71, Aaron and Emre encounter another pair of survivors: Medhathobo and The Jade Grue. Aaron and Emre assume the new arrivals are in league with SP Cakes and assault their fort.
